I am both a psychotherapist, with a MSW (Master of Social Work degree) and 20 years of experience, and an energetic bodyworker with 660 clock hours of training in Polarity Therapy. I am a graduate of Bates College (1996) and Smith College School for Social Work (2002). I am also an Access Bars Practitioner, and completed my CS1 certification in Craniosacral Therapy in September of 2022. My specialty is my blended approach to mental health care.
I enjoy bringing out of the box thinking and a holistic view to my psychotherapy work, and also blend my psychotherapy skills with bodywork practice and energy work to deepen the work, if you so desire.
